Transfer email settings from Outlook Express to another computer

Can anyone advise how to copy my outlook express and outlook settings from my old computer to this new one running vista email ?

To transfer outlook express account settings from old computer to new computer, perform the following steps:
  1. Attach Removable media like Pen drive or USB drive to your computer system.

  2. Open Outlook Express

  3. Click Tools from the menu bar and select the Accounts option.

  4. The number of mail accounts configured in Outlook Express will be displayed.

  5. Select the account of which the settings are required to be transferred.



  6. Now click the Export button from right panel of the window.

  7. The window to save the settings file on any other removable media will be displayed.

  8. The Outlook Express mail account settings file will get saved in mail.servername.IAF file extension.

  9. Save it on the attached removable media.

To import the saved settings file to new computer, perform the following steps:
  1. Attach the Removable media to drive.

  2. Open Outlook Express

  3. Click Tools from the menu bar and select the Accounts option.

  4. Click the Import button from right panel of the window.

  5. Select the mail.servername.IAF file from the removable media and click Open.

  6. The .IAF file will get configured in Outlook Express
Thus the mail account settings of Outlook Express are successfully transferred from one computer to another. You can also modify these settings by selecting an account name and clicking Properties button from the right panel of the window.

The easiest way is to use Windows Easy Transfer.

http://windowshelp.microsoft.com/Win...449561033.mspx

To do it manually you would export your address book and account settings in XP to removable media. Copy the folder with the .dbx files to the removable media. On the Vista pc import the data into Windows Mail.
